Paving of 2.7-km road in Guimaras, boosts economy, tourism – DPWH  


The 2.7 kilometer road pavement in Nueva Valancia, Guimaras has been opened to motorists and is now benefiting locals and tourists, the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) reported on Tuesday, Aug. 23.

Citing a report from District Engineer Rhodora Nuñal, DPWH Region 6 Director Nerie D. Bueno said the P56.2 million project will give better access to markets, schools, clinics, and other commercial establishments.

Bueno said that with the road upgraded from gravel to concrete, it now shortens the traveling time to nearby towns and barangays and provides access to popular attractions in the province such as the Sun Sea Resort, Rumagangrang Beach Resort, and to Yato Island. for tourists.

Traversing Barangays Cabalagnan and Salvacion, the road project is also projected to improve socio-economic activities in the municipality by providing an alternate route to Cabalagnan Fish Landing, the main drop-off point for fresh seafood in Nueva Valencia. (Jun Marcos Tadios)
